Background
The dust collector is a very convenient tool when people clean the health, and along with the large-scale popularization of dust collectors, its style and function are also more and more, but its theory of operation is big same little different, all inhales the air through the motor, makes the interior vacuumness that forms of dirt box, and foreign matter such as dust is just inhaled the dirt box in the lump, and the rethread filters step by step, intercepts foreign matter such as dust in the dirt box, the air discharge equipment after will filtering.
When the existing ash collecting box is used, the ash collecting box does not have the function of preventing the ash from being installed in a neglected manner, so that once the inside of the ash collecting box is not provided with the HEPA, the motor can be damaged for a long time, and the use cost is increased; and because the dust collecting box does not have the function of being convenient for to clear up, in case do not clear up the dust collecting box inside, will lead to the inside dust of dust collecting box to pile up for a long time, and then influence the work of dust catcher.

The connecting handle is characterized in that a connecting block is fixedly mounted at the top of the side wall of the connecting handle, the outer surface of the connecting block is attached to the inner wall of the connecting groove, and the width of the connecting block is smaller than that of the connecting handle.
Wherein, the center department demountable installation of ka tai lateral wall has the protection network, the surface of protection network has four connecting plates with circular array fixed mounting, the middle part demountable installation of connecting plate surface has connecting bolt, and connecting bolt's lateral wall passes through the connecting plate with the nut looks adaptation of being connected of the installation is inlayed to ka tai lateral wall bottom.
The top of the side wall of the clamping table is fixedly provided with an installation block, and the surface area of the installation block is larger than that of the connection block.
The ash collecting box body comprises a first box body, an internal thread and a collecting barrel, wherein the internal thread is formed in one side of the inner wall of the first box body, and the collecting barrel is arranged on the other side of the inner wall of the first box body.
One side of the inner wall of the first box body is connected with a second box body through the internal thread, the side wall of the second box body is communicated with a threaded connecting cylinder, and one end of the threaded connecting cylinder is matched with the inner wall of the first box body.
The other side wall of the second box body is communicated with the side wall of the mounting shell, and the cross sectional area of the second box body is larger than that of the threaded connection cylinder.

Example 2:
referring to fig. 4, the dust collecting box body 6 includes a first box body 61, an internal thread 62 and a collecting barrel 63, the internal thread 62 is provided on one side of the inner wall of the first box body 61, the collecting barrel 63 is provided on the other side of the inner wall of the first box body 61, one side of the inner wall of the first box body 61 is connected to a second box body 64 through the internal thread 62, the side wall of the second box body 64 is communicated with a threaded connection barrel 65, one end of the threaded connection barrel 65 is matched with the inner wall of the first box body 61, the other side wall of the second box body 64 is communicated with the side wall of the mounting case 7, and the cross-sectional area of the second box body 64 is larger than the cross-sectional area of the threaded connection barrel 65.
The method has the beneficial effects that: the internal thread 62 and the threaded connection cylinder 65 are arranged to facilitate the separation of the first box body 61 and the second box body 64, so that the disassembly between the box bodies is convenient, and the practicability of the device is enhanced.
The utility model discloses a working process as follows:
when the dust collector main body 1 works, in order to prevent a user from neglecting to install the HEPA body 10 when the dust collector main body 1 is assembled with the ash collecting box body 6, the HEPA body 10 and the clamping table 11 are arranged, the HEPA body 10 and the clamping table 11 need to be connected firstly, then the HEPA body 10 and the installation shell 7 are connected, and then the assembled ash collecting box body 6 and the dust collector main body 1 are connected, so that the dust collector main body 1 can be ensured to work normally, because the HEPA body 10 and the telescopic lug 8 inside the installation shell 7 are matched, the HEPA body 10 and the clamping table 11 are matched, and the clamping table 11 cannot be matched with the telescopic lug 8, when the user forgets to install the HEPA body 10, the ash collecting box body 6 cannot be connected with the dust collector main body 1, so that the user cannot install the HEPA body 10, and the practicability of the device is enhanced.
